MATCH RECAP, pres. by Provident Bank: Red Bulls Score Two, Take Three Points at Home

Danny Royer struck in the first half and Bradley Wright-Phillips added a second-half goal to lift the New York Red Bulls to a 2-1 win over Seattle Sounders FC Wednesday night at Red Bull Arena.


Royer put the Red Bulls (8-4-2) in front on 37 minutes, racing in at the back post to tap in a low ball across the face of goal by Florian Valot for his fourth goal of the season.


The Red Bulls doubled their lead just seven minutes after the break when Wright-Phillips put a glancing header past Stefan Frei for his 10th goal of the season. It was the first career assist for Ethan Kutler, who whipped in the cross.


Harry Shipp pulled Seattle (3-8-2) to within a goal three minutes from full time, but it was the visitors weren't able to find the equalizer.
